Why analysis comes before tooling
Automation built on a poorly understood process makes the poor process faster. That is not an improvement, it is entrenchment — afterwards the detour is cast in software and harder to change than it was before.
So this does not start with picking a tool. It starts with an afternoon next to the people doing the work. Not in a meeting room with the leadership team, but at the desk: which file gets copied where? Where does someone wait for someone else? Which step exists only because something went wrong once, three years ago?
The result is a sober list: where the time goes, which steps are worth automating, and which are better simply abolished. Sometimes the best automation is deleting a step entirely.
What usually turns out to be automatable
The worthwhile candidates look much the same everywhere: tasks that happen often, follow clear rules, and demand nothing from anyone professionally.

Connect systems instead of replacing them
In most companies the real problem is not one bad system but the gap between several good ones. The CRM knows something the ERP needs. File storage holds the document that should end up in the quote. Today that gap is bridged by people who retype and forward.
Those gaps can nearly always be closed without touching any of the systems involved, using the interfaces they already ship with. It is unspectacular, considerably cheaper than a replacement, and it leaves the tools your people already know alone.
Where AI helps, it joins in: sorting free text, pulling the relevant details out of an e-mail, preparing a draft that a human approves. Where conventional rules are enough, conventional rules are what you get — they are predictable and cheaper to run.
The person stays, the typing goes
AI does not replace people, it amplifies them. Whoever did the work before still does it afterwards and still makes the same decisions. What changes is what fills the day: what disappears is the retyping, the forwarding and the checking up.
That is not a reassurance formula, it is a condition for the thing working at all. Automation that arrives looking like redundancies gets quietly undermined by exactly the people whose cooperation it needs. That is why the analysis phase involves talking with the team, not only about them.

How long does an analysis take?
For a bounded area, usually one to two days on site plus write-up. What you get at the end is a list with effort and expected return per candidate — including when the conclusion is that automating it is not worth it.
Do we have to change our systems?
As a rule, no. The normal case is connecting the systems you already have through their interfaces. Changing systems is a separate, far bigger project and should never be a side effect of an automation exercise.
What happens to our data if AI is involved?
We settle that before anything is built: which data may leave the building and which may not. If data cannot leave, that is a requirement like any other — not a reason to bury the project.
